Lower Jones Valley Campground

About: This campground is located in a small canyon adjacent to the lake. The Jones Valley boat ramp and the Clickipudi Trail are located nearby. Hogdon Meadow Campground (Yosemite National Park)

Location: On the Big Oak Flat Road (Highway 120), about 45 minutes northwest of Yosemite Valley and adjacent to the Big Oak Flat Entrance Station Elevation: 4,900 ft (1,500 m) Open: All year Reservations: Required and available online from approximately mid-April through mid-October. Lower Deadman Campground

About: Elevation 7800 feet. 15 sites. Campround will accommodate a 45 vehicle. No drinking water is available. Pit toilets are available. 21 day stay limit. No bear lockers available. Lower Chiquito Campground

About: Campsites are located along Chiquito Creek. Good shade provided by cedar and pine trees. Each site has a table, fire rings and grill. Toilets are vault. Snake Lake Campground

About: Located in the Meadow Valley area off of Bucks Lake Rd., Snake Lake Campground boasts shady, lakeside campsites for both tent and RVs. There are no reservations and no fee for camping.
